This recipe for Greek-Style Meat Sauce {Makaronia Me Kima} is a 30-minute dish full of authentic flavors – fresh mint, cinnamon & allspice.

A plate of curly pasta topped high with Greek Style Meat Sauce

This recipe for Greek Style Meat pasta Sauce is 30 minute dish which infuses spaghetti Bolognese with the flavors of Greece.

Makaronia Me Kima

In Greece, this dish is called Makaronia Me Kima, which simply translates as spaghetti with meat sauce.  I didn’t use spaghetti, but this recipe uses all the authentic flavors you’d expect in Greek food.

What Meat For Greek-Style Meat Sauce {Makaronia Me Kima}

Growing up, we had a close family friend from Greece who made this all the time.  She used ground lamb, but most recipes call for beef which is what this recipe calls for.  I prefer lamb,  If you haven’t tried it – give it a try!  The flavors are delicious!

Why this recipe works: 

  • The traditional Greek ingredients of fresh mint, cinnamon, and allspice give this dish a flavorful richness.
  • It’s a simple recipe that’s quick to prepare, making it perfect for busy weeknight meals.
  • Using fresh ingredients, rather than jarred sauce makes this recipe a much healthier option.

How to make  Greek-Style Meat Sauce {Makaronia Me Kima}

Start with cooking the onion until soft, add the garlic, followed by the cinnamon, allspice, ground cloves, and dried oregano.  Cook to release the flavors.The onions cooking with the spices

Add the meat.The meat added to the pan with the onion and garlic mixture

Fry until fully cooked and no pink shows at all in the meat (about 8 minutes).  Add the tomato paste and stir into the meat.The tomato paste mixed into the meat

Fry another minute and stir in the wine and allow to cook down.The wine being added to the beef mixture Add the tomatoes, sugar, parsley, and fresh mint.The fresh herbs and tomatoes added to the pan with the meat mixture.

Stir together, season with salt and pepper.The Greek Style Meat Sauce {Makaronia Me Kima} cooking in the pan

Lower the heat and simmer for 25 minutes.The cooked Greek Style Meat Sauce {Makaronia Me Kima} ready to serve

Serve over pasta and enjoy!

Cook’s Tips:

  • This recipe calls for ground beef, but authentic recipes would call for lamb.  You could easily use ground pork or turkey too.
  • The longer you simmer, the deeper the flavor, so if you have the time, cook the sauce longer and add a little water if it gets too thick.
  • For a more authentic combination, instead of serving with Parmesan cheese, try using Greek Mizithra cheese.
  • For a low-fat option, try dry frying the meat and adding cooking spray when adding the onions and garlic.
  • Different regions of Greece use varied ingredients.  Other options are adding cayenne pepper, ground cloves, bay leaves or topped with mozzarella cheese.

Recipe

Greek Style Meat Sauce {Makaronia Me Kima}

An easy traditional Greek style meat sauce for pasta.  Perfect for busy weeknight suppers.
4.81 from 36 votes
Print
Prep Time: 5 minutes mins
Cook Time: 25 minutes mins
Total Time: 30 minutes mins
Serves 4 servings

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 large red onion (chopped or sliced)
  • 3 cloves garlic (chopped)
  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1 tablespoon tomato paste
  • ½ cup white wine (or red wine)
  • 28 oz can crushed or pureed tomatoes
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on ground allspice
  • ½ teaspoon ground cloves
  • 1 tablespoon dried oregano
  • ½ teaspoon sugar
  • 4 leaves fresh mint (chopped)
  • fresh parsley ((a good handful) chopped)
  • Salt and pepper (to taste)
  • ½ lb pasta

Instructions

  • Heat 2 tablespoons of the oil in a large pan over medium heat. Cook the onion until soft, add the garlic, followed by the cinnamon, allspice, ground cloves, and dried oregano. Cook to release the flavors.
  • Fry until fully cooked and no pink shows at all in the meat (about 8 minutes). Add the tomato paste and stir into the meat.
  • Stir in the wine and allow to cook down.
  • Add the tomatoes, sugar, parsley, and fresh mint. Stir together, season with salt and pepper. 
  • Lower the heat and simmer for 25 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, cook the pasta according to the package instructions. Drain and serve topped with the sauce.
Slow Cooker
  • Follow the stovetop instructions through step 4. Then transfer to a slow cooker, cover, and cook on low for 8 hours or on high for 3 to 4 hours, stirring occasionally.

    In Greece we put clove too , which is really important for that dish . In fact if you have dried oregano , cinnamon and clove you can cook almost any greek dish . Also for the perfect Makaronia me kima , you have to put grated greek cheese on top of your spaghetti . And if you know this recipe you can make pastitsio or mousaka !!!!!!!

    Greek style meat sauce is very different from other tomato based meat sauces because of the spices that are used. Cinnamon and allspice are both commonly used in Greek cooking but I also find that omitting one or the other is still authentic. It all depends on your preferences.
